100 Examples of sentences containing the adjective "stormy"

Definition

The adjective stormy describes weather characterized by strong winds, heavy rain, thunder, and lightning. It can also refer to a tumultuous or turbulent situation or relationship, marked by conflict or emotional upheaval.
